HEIC is the container Apple uses for photos in the HEIF standard — about half the file size of JPEG at similar quality, but not universally supported. That gap is why conversion exists. Learn more →

Recent iPhones shoot HEIC by default, and Windows often cannot open it without extra codecs. Converting to JPEG before sending makes photos open everywhere. Learn more →
